You want to make sure that you always apply your wax in the same direction the hair grows. The hair will not be removed with the wax if you don't do it in this manner. So I'm going, the hair grows down, and it's, sometimes facial hair tends to grow in several directions. So if this hair grows in the direction then go this way. If this hair grows in this direction, then go that way and separate your sections. But make sure you always apply in the way the hair grows, in the direction the hair is growing. It's growing this way, I'm applying this way. Hard wax. Remember we're going to put it on nice and thick so we have something to grab a hold of. And then I'm going to remove against the direction of the hair growth. Perfect. This is a good little secret tip. If you have wax that you've previously removed, take that and reapply it to the wax the next section that you're ready to take off, because it gives you like a handle, something to grab a hold of and remove that wax. Wax sticks to wax, so you can go through and dab that on any little pieces that might be left and remove those wax. So remember, apply with the growth, remove against the growth.
